NTR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2022 in Review

695 of the 6,221 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Nutrien (NTR) for Q4 2022, worth a combined $24.6B — down 12% from $28B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 120 funds closed out of NTR and 88 opened new positions — a net loss of 32 holders — while 294 trimmed existing stakes and 193 added.

The largest buyer was National Bank of Canada, adding an estimated $255M. The largest seller was Fidelity Investments, cutting an estimated $771M.
